Lost keystore

I had uploaded my app to Android Market buzztouch 1.4 some time ago. Today I updated the app, but I had deleted the previous keystore and created new. Now market says, that The apk must be signed with the same certificates as the previous version. But I don't have this certificate, and don't want to delete and upload once again the application, because it have active users. What can I do to sign app with new certificate? Some guys had suggested me extract certificate using jar keytools but i don't know, how to use it this link http://docs.oracle.com/javase/1.3/docs/tooldocs/win32/keytool.html Please help me . .. .
